Re: Super Stock Challenger at Barret Jackson

Boy those were some beautiful cars at the BJ Auction. The one I had my eye on was lot 462- the 1970 Plymouth Cuda' 440/6. I loved everything about that one but would have perfered a 4sp. It went for $110k which is out of my range. Seems all I do over the past few years is read about these old muscle cars. Still have my 68 Pontiac Firebird I had in college (all original) but it's not as appealing as the Cudas or Challengers. I've been watching trends lately and was hoping thing would cool down so someone of my income (teacher) might at least have a hope of owning one. The new Challenger might make that happen.
